What is the legal protection of the rights of LGBT+ people in Mexico?

Mexico In Mexico, significant progress has been made in protecting the rights of l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ender (LGBT+) people. There are laws and policies that prohibit discrimination based on sexual orientation and gender identity, and rights such as equal marriage, gender identity change, and access to health and education without discrimination are recognized. However, challenges still persist in fully guaranteeing these rights and eliminating discrimination and violence.

What is the Special Permanence Permit for Venezuelan Migrants (PEP-MV) in Colombia?

The Special Permanence Permit for Venezuelan Migrants (PEP-MV) in Colombia is a document that allows Venezuelan citizens to regularize their immigration status and access benefits in the country.
